About the Department of Child Services:
Join a team that engages with families and children to improve lives meaningfully. DCS engages authentically with children who are victims of abuse or neglect and strengthens families through services that focus on family support and preservation. The Department also administers family preservation and prevention services, foster care, and child support throughout Indiana. You will relentlessly pursue permanency for children and families through reunification, guardianship, adoption, or support youth in making a successful transition to adulthood. Role Overview:
The Older Youth Case Manager works with a specialized caseload of adolescents to support their transition to adulthood and independence by ensuring they are achieving goals in their case plans. You will assess progress, maintain documentation, plan for needs, assist in building support systems for successful living and, when necessary, attend court hearings. You will also work with field office staff to ensure eligible youth are supported at each juncture in the Older Youth Timeline.
